ポルカドット(DOT)活用の幅を広げる最新ツール選!



ポルカドット(DOT)活用の幅を広げる最新ツール選!


ポルカドット(DOT)活用の幅を広げる最新ツール選!

ポルカドット(Polkadot)は、異なるブロックチェーン間の相互運用性を実現する革新的なプラットフォームです。その柔軟性と拡張性から、DeFi(分散型金融)、NFT(非代替性トークン)、ゲーム、サプライチェーン管理など、多岐にわたる分野での活用が期待されています。本稿では、ポルカドットの可能性を最大限に引き出すための最新ツールを厳選し、その機能と活用方法を詳細に解説します。

ポルカドットの基礎知識

ポルカドットは、パラチェーンと呼ばれる独立したブロックチェーンを接続し、相互運用を可能にするリレーチェーンを中核としています。このアーキテクチャにより、各パラチェーンは独自のガバナンス、トークンエコノミー、およびユースケースを持つことができます。ポルカドットの主な特徴は以下の通りです。

  • 相互運用性: 異なるブロックチェーン間でデータや資産をシームレスに交換できます。
  • スケーラビリティ: パラチェーンの並列処理により、高いトランザクション処理能力を実現します。
  • ガバナンス: コミュニティ主導のガバナンスシステムにより、プラットフォームの進化を決定します。
  • アップグレード性: フォークレスアップグレードにより、プラットフォームを中断することなく最新の状態に保つことができます。

ポルカドット開発に役立つツール

Substrate

Substrateは、ポルカドットの基盤となるブロックチェーン開発フレームワークです。Rustプログラミング言語で記述されており、開発者はカスタムブロックチェーンを効率的に構築できます。Substrateは、モジュール式アーキテクチャを採用しており、必要な機能を柔軟に追加・変更できます。

主な機能:

  • モジュール式アーキテクチャ: 必要な機能を自由に選択し、組み合わせることができます。
  • WebAssembly(Wasm)サポート: 高速で安全なスマートコントラクトの実行を可能にします。
  • 豊富なライブラリ: 開発を支援する様々なライブラリが提供されています。
  • テストフレームワーク: 徹底的なテストを容易にするツールが用意されています。

Substrateを利用することで、開発者はポルカドットのエコシステムに統合された独自のパラチェーンを構築し、様々なアプリケーションを開発できます。

Polkadot JS Apps

Polkadot JS Appsは、ポルカドットのエコシステムとインタラクトするためのWebアプリケーションです。ウォレット管理、トランザクションの送信、ブロックチェーンデータの閲覧など、様々な機能を提供します。

主な機能:

  • ウォレット管理: ポルカドットのアカウントを安全に管理できます。
  • トランザクション構築: カスタムトランザクションを構築し、送信できます。
  • ブロックチェーンエクスプローラー: ブロックチェーンのデータを詳細に閲覧できます。
  • ガバナンス: ポルカドットのガバナンスプロセスに参加できます。

Polkadot JS Appsは、開発者だけでなく、ポルカドットのエコシステムを利用するすべてのユーザーにとって不可欠なツールです。

Parity Signer

Parity Signerは、ポルカドットのアカウントのセキュリティを強化するためのハードウェアウォレットです。オフラインで秘密鍵を保管し、トランザクションの署名を行うことで、ハッキングのリスクを軽減します。

主な機能:

  • オフライン秘密鍵保管: 秘密鍵を安全にオフラインで保管します。
  • トランザクション署名: トランザクションを安全に署名します。
  • 多要素認証: PINコードや生体認証による多要素認証をサポートします。
  • USB接続: パソコンにUSBで接続して使用します。

Parity Signerは、ポルカドットの資産を安全に管理するための信頼性の高いソリューションです。

Acala Network

Acala Networkは、ポルカドット上で構築されたDeFiハブです。ステーブルコイン(aUSD)、DEX(分散型取引所)、レンディングプラットフォームなど、様々なDeFiアプリケーションを提供します。

主な機能:

  • aUSDステーブルコイン: 米ドルにペッグされたステーブルコインを提供します。
  • DEX: 様々なトークンを取引できる分散型取引所を提供します。
  • レンディング: 暗号資産を貸し借りできるプラットフォームを提供します。
  • 流動性プール: トークン流動性を提供するプールを提供します。

Acala Networkは、ポルカドットのエコシステムにおけるDeFiの中心的な役割を担っています。

Moonbeam

Moonbeamは、ポルカドット上で動作するEthereum互換のパラチェーンです。Ethereumの既存のスマートコントラクトやアプリケーションをポルカドットのエコシステムに簡単に移植できます。

主な機能:

  • Ethereum互換性: Ethereumのスマートコントラクトやアプリケーションをそのまま利用できます。
  • Solidityサポート: Ethereumで使用されているSolidityプログラミング言語をサポートします。
  • Web3 API: EthereumのWeb3 APIをサポートします。
  • クロスチェーンブリッジ: Ethereumとポルカドット間の資産移動を可能にします。

Moonbeamは、Ethereum開発者がポルカドットのエコシステムに参入するための最適なゲートウェイです。

その他の有用なツール

  • Talisman: Polkadot JS AppsのGUIフロントエンドを提供します。
  • Block Explorer: ポルカドットのブロックチェーンデータを視覚的に表示します。
  • Polkadot-JS API: ポルカドットのブロックチェーンとインタラクトするためのJavaScriptライブラリです。

まとめ

ポルカドットは、相互運用性とスケーラビリティに優れた革新的なブロックチェーンプラットフォームです。Substrate、Polkadot JS Apps、Parity Signer、Acala Network、Moonbeamなど、様々なツールを活用することで、ポルカドットの可能性を最大限に引き出すことができます。これらのツールは、開発者だけでなく、ポルカドットのエコシステムを利用するすべてのユーザーにとって不可欠な存在です。ポルカドットのエコシステムは、今後も進化を続け、より多くのアプリケーションとサービスが登場することが期待されます。これらのツールを積極的に活用し、ポルカドットの未来を共に創造していきましょう。


前の記事

ダイ(DAI)で得られる分配金や報酬の仕組みを解説!

次の記事

ビットバンクでの入金・出金エラーの原因と解決法まとめ

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です